Columbus Grove put another one in the bag on Friday to keep their perfect season alive. They took down the Patrick Henry Patriots 27-13. Given the Bulldogs' advantage in MaxPreps' Ohio football rankings (they are ranked 45th, while the Patriots are ranked 200th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Trenton Barraza was a one-man wrecking crew for Columbus Grove as he rushed for 148 yards and two touchdowns. Barraza is crushing it when it comes to rushing yards: he's rushed for at least 100 every time he's taken the field this season.
Columbus Grove's defense was in the mix too, especially the secondary: they snagged three passes before it was all said and done. It was truly a group effort as Trevon Baxter, Aiden Patrick, and Kylan Mayes picked up one apiece. Patrick also put in work on the defensive side of the ball, making four total tackles and defending two passes in addition to snagging an interception.
Columbus Grove's win bumped their record up to 3-0. As for Patrick Henry, their defeat was their first of the season and makes their record 2-1.
Columbus Grove will take on Spencerville at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. Columbus Grove is looking to tack on another W to their four-game streak on the road dating back to last season. As for Patrick Henry, they will be playing at home against Evergreen at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.
